## Service Accounts: ReportForge Exports

All scheduled exports from ReportForge are rendered in UTC by default. The `tz-override` flag on the export job only affects column formatting, not the query window — a common source of off-by-one-day reports. If a customer in the Velmara region reports missing rows, check the job's anchor timezone before touching the scheduler. To re-run an export manually, authenticate against the ReportForge admin endpoint with the service account key below.

service key, yadug-bajog: zpat3_pou

## Formula sandbox tuning

User-supplied formulas in Gridmoor execute inside a restricted interpreter with hard ceilings on time, memory, and call depth. Reviewers should confirm any change to these ceilings is justified in the PR description, since raising them widens the abuse surface. Defaults were chosen from production traces. The current limits are as follows.

limits module of tafog-fawip:
WEIGHTS = {
    "julix": 57,
    "lamys": 992,
    "kasvan": 209,
    "quenok": 750,
    "alddor": 259,
    "oliath": 1009,
    "wenix": 815,
}

To the release manager: I'm passing ownership of the Pellwick deep-link router to Sorrel before the 4.2 cut. The intent-matching table now lives in the Farrowgate config service; stale entries were purged last sprint. Watch the fallback route — it silently swallows malformed slugs, which inflated our drop-off metrics in March. The staging resolver needs its keystore unlocked before each regression pass, and that keystore accepts only one credential. For the signing vault, the recovery phrase is noted directly below.

recovery phrase for tafog-fafog: novix-novdor-fraath-brieth-olieth-oliix-rusix-wenion-julax-druox